Class 1 biological safety cabinets are designed to provide personnel and environmental protection. They are commonly used in laboratories, hospitals, and pharmaceutical facilities to handle potentially hazardous biological materials, such as bacteria, viruses, and other microorganisms. These cabinets are enclosed workspaces with built-in filtration systems that help prevent the release of harmful contaminants into the surrounding area.
One of the key features of Class 1 biological safety cabinets is the airflow system. These cabinets are equipped with a fan that continuously draws air from the laboratory into the cabinet, creating negative pressure to contain any potential contaminants inside. The air is then filtered through high-efficiency particulate air (HEPA) filters to remove any airborne particles, ensuring a clean and safe working environment for researchers.
Another important feature of Class 1 biological safety cabinets is the exhaust system. The filtered air is exhausted back into the laboratory or through a dedicated ducting system to the outside, preventing the buildup of contaminants inside the cabinet. This helps maintain a healthy and sterile working environment, reducing the risk of exposure to biological hazards.
Class 1 biological safety cabinets are also equipped with a sash or a sliding door that can be adjusted to control airflow and provide a barrier between the researcher and the biological materials inside the cabinet. This helps prevent accidental spills or splashes, further reducing the risk of exposure. Additionally, the cabinet is lined with a stainless steel or other chemical-resistant material that is easy to clean and decontaminate after each use.
It is important to note that Class 1 biological safety cabinets are not suitable for handling volatile chemicals, radioactive materials, or biohazard level 3 and 4 agents. Specialized cabinets, such as Class 2 and Class 3 biological safety cabinets, are designed for these specific applications. Therefore, it is essential to assess the type of biological material being handled and select the appropriate safety cabinet for the task.
